How much do full time pmt j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for full time pmt in the United States is $37,714.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$33,500.00 and $41,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Payment Spec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Payment Specialist, you need a solid understanding of financial transactions, payment processing, and accounting principles, generally supported by a degree in finance or a related field. Familiarity with payment processing software, ERP systems like SAP or Oracle, and relevant certifications such as Certified Payments Professional (CPP) are typically required.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and strong communication skills help you efficiently resolve discrepancies and collaborate with internal and external stakeholders. These skills ensure accurate and timely payments, minimize errors, and maintain trust in financial operations.

Job description

Direct Support Professional (DSP) โ€“ Residential | Full-Time | 36 Hours Weekly

Join CCARC and make a meaningful difference in the lives of adults with intellectual and developmental disabilities in a residential setting. As a DSP, youโ€™ll provide hands-on support while helping individuals live safely, independently, and with dignity.

Schedule:

  • Thursday: 8:00 PM โ€“ 9:00 AM
  • Friday: 8:00 PM โ€“ 8:00 AM
  • Saturday: 8:00 PM โ€“ 8:00 AM

Full-Time | 36 Hours Weekly

Responsibilities:
  • Support individuals with daily living skills, personal care, and community activities
  • Assist with meals, medications, hygiene, and household routines
  • Encourage independence, confidence, and social engagement
  • Transport individuals to appointments, outings, and recreational activities
  • Maintain documentation and communicate with team members and families
  • Help create a safe, positive, and supportive home environment
Qualifications:
  • High School Diploma or GED
  • Valid Driverโ€™s License and reliable transportation
  • Ability to complete required trainings (CPR, PMT, Medication Certification, etc.)
  • Compassionate, dependable, and team-oriented mindset
